Income and economy in ZIP 90633

Median household income in ZIP 90633 is about $100,189 — about 33% above the U.S. median ($75,149).

On socioeconomic markers, US5 shows a poverty rate of 10.8%; unemployment rate near 8.4%; 19.1% of adults with a bachelor’s degree or higher (about 14.6 points below the national share (33.7%)).

Labor and commute patterns include leading industry context around Retail trade, Healthcare, and Manufacturing; about 12.0% of workers reporting work-from-home (about 3.2 points below the U.S. share (15.2%)); a mean commute of about 180.0 minutes (U.S. average near 26.8).

Housing and affordability in ZIP 90633

Median home value is about $653,100 — about 88% above the U.S. median home value ($348,079).

Housing tenure and rents show median gross rent around $1,448 (about 25% above the U.S. median rent ($1,163)), and owner-occupancy near 60.3% (about 5.1 points below the national owner-occupancy rate (65.4%)).

To comfortably buy a median-priced home in ZIP 90633, a household would need roughly $180,000 in annual income under a 20% down, 30-year loan at 6.8% (illustrative), keeping housing costs near 28% of income. Estimated monthly PITI is about $4,195. That is about 80% above the local median household income ($100,189), so the median earner would likely stretch or need a larger down payment. Rates, taxes, insurance, and HOA fees vary — treat this as a planning estimate, not a lender quote.
